Output 124991a6d11c0dfaaec6ea05c5cf1d62df0c2cbf0b00ef617a04109c75715250:1

value
38642400
script pubkey
OP_0 OP_PUSHBYTES_20 81b4ae609c613830a99107a83b33eb5dd0242ca0
address
ltc1qsx62ucyuvyurp2v3q75rkvltthgzgt9q3f0df6
transaction
124991a6d11c0dfaaec6ea05c5cf1d62df0c2cbf0b00ef617a04109c75715250
spent
true